Output ddabaa29a28faa22e543859cd79cde677ae6dee01f3027b10f1efd467ca921b6:0

value
28534993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720ee0dcd2c45513c7db7bcb9f6c4dcb55fb992e OP_EQUAL
address
MJJF64navXx816Kvh7LFP4n3rt1ER9vpYW
transaction
ddabaa29a28faa22e543859cd79cde677ae6dee01f3027b10f1efd467ca921b6
spent
true